  • Mastering Paintless Dent Repair

    Paintless Dent Repair (PDR) is a sophisticated technique that helps fix small dents and imperfections from vehicle bodywork while preserving the factory paint. This process utilizes specialized tools to carefully manipulate the damaged area to its factory condition. The equipment is made to access the backside of the panel, allowing precise manipulation while preserving the finish.

    This approach is perfect for smaller and medium dents, mainly those resulting from sports equipment, hailstorms, or small accidents.

    Looking at the expense comparison, Paintless Dent Repair usually emerges the more budget-friendly option in comparison with standard dent repair approaches. Traditional repair techniques typically involve surface preparation, body fillers, and new paint, which requires more work hours but may compromise the original paintwork.

    On the other hand, PDR keeps the original paint and needs considerably less material and time. This creates a smaller overall cost and often a quicker turnaround. By opting for PDR, you're going with a repair process that prevents potential decreases in your vehicle's resale value because of mismatched paint or noticeable filler compounds.

    What Kinds of Damage Do We Fix?

    Vehicle owners frequently wonder about the extent of damage that can be resolved using paintless dent repair (PDR). It's essential to understand that this method works exceptionally well when repairing small to medium-sized dents, particularly when the paint hasn't been damaged.

    Paintless Dent Repair is ideal for correcting small dings that typically happen because of everyday incidents including shopping carts hitting your car or minor impacts from rocks. This approach is particularly effective for addressing crease damage, which are often more complex due to the distorted surface.

    Furthermore, PDR remains the top technique for restoring hail damage, which often leaves many dents throughout your vehicle's exterior. Because these dents typically don't damage the paint layer, they can be professionally repaired using PDR, maintaining your car's pristine finish.

    You'll find PDR extremely useful for correcting door dents, which commonly happen in parking lots. Different from standard repair approaches that may need sanding, filler, or repainting, PDR functions by meticulously reshaping the damaged area back to its original form, guaranteeing no trace of the damage remains.

    If you're dealing with non-penetrative dents when the paint isn't compromised, PDR successfully bring back your vehicle's appearance without the hassles of conventional restoration approaches.

    Our Professional Service Process

    Our experienced professionals begin the paintless dent repair (PDR) process by thoroughly examining the scope of the damage on your vehicle. They precisely examine each dent, evaluating its dimensions, severity, and positioning to establish the most suitable repair method. This preliminary assessment is vital as it dictates the specific dent repair methods that'll be implemented.

    After completing the evaluation, our skilled technicians employ their extensive expertise to carefully access the dent from beneath. They could disconnect body panels or trim components to access the reverse side of the dent. With professional equipment, they precisely work the metal back into its original form from the interior outward. This process is meticulous and demands a precise approach and a deep understanding of metal properties.

    Does Paintless Dent Repair Impact Your Automobile's Resale Price?

    The resale value of your vehicle isn't compromised by paintless dent repair.

    In fact, this technique typically maintains it through keeping the factory paint and body condition. This method repairs dents without needing repainting or filler, which can be clear evidence of previous damage to prospective purchasers.

    It's an excellent choice if you're focused on maintaining your vehicle in excellent condition for selling later, as it leaves the exterior looking original and unblemished.
